“At every turn, this chapter will face us with our inability to call the tune and master our affairs. On one level after another, we find ourselves pinned down, hunted down, and disoriented” (Derek Kidner). Yet, throughout the chapter, Solomon knows that it will eventually be well with those who fear God (8:12), and eventually, judgment will catch up to the sinner, even if he was viewed as a hero in this life (8:10-13).
